Rollator Cost Comparison: A Strategic Approach for Procurement Managers

When procurement managers compare prices from different rollator manufacturers, the true objective is to identify the supplier that offers the best balance of price, performance, and partnership potential.

1. Standardize Your Evaluation Framework

Start by setting uniform technical and quality standards for all suppliers. Consistent criteria prevent unfair comparisons and allow you to focus on meaningful differences.

2. Break Down Total Cost Components

Include not only the unit price but also shipping, import fees, installation, training, and anticipated maintenance costs. This holistic view exposes hidden expenses.

3. Evaluate Reliability Through Case Studies

Request documented examples of the supplier’s past performance, including delivery timelines, service responsiveness, and quality consistency.

4. Consider After-Sales Support

Suppliers who provide accessible spare parts, flexible warranties, and responsive technical support contribute to reduced downtime and extended product life.

5. Weigh Compliance and Ethical Standards

Ethical sourcing, safety certifications, and environmental responsibility should form part of your decision-making process, even if they come at a marginally higher price.

6. Apply a Weighted Scoring Matrix

Assign numerical weights to categories like cost, quality, compliance, support, and innovation. This quantifies comparisons and reduces subjective bias.

Conclusion

Strategic rollator procurement is about securing long-term value, not just a lower invoice. By adopting a standardized, transparent cost comparison framework, purchasing managers can make informed decisions that align with both operational and organizational priorities.
